Study On Key Technologies Of Open Source GIS In Seismic Analysis And Forecast System

Earthquake analysis and forecast is an important segment in the work of disaster prevention,it mainly consists of the following two sections: firstly,predict time,location and magnitude of earthquakes that will take place in long term,mid-term and short term according to precursory information anomalies in regions with good monitoring bases and profound studies of local earthquakes,so that the alleviation of the damage caused could be maximized.Secondly,after damaging earthquakes took place,seismic department could synthetically analyze according to materials such as precursory data and earthquake sequence and structures,determine the after-trend of the earthquake,forecast following earthquakes to a certain extent.Earthquake analysis and forecast software MapSIS is an important method for seismic researchers to analyze the trends of earthquakes and a significant tool to form opinions about earthquake forecast.But due to copyright thus software cannot be used generally,therefore,it is very necessary to develop an earthquake analysis and forecast software based on open source GIS architecture.This system is based on C/S system architecture and open source GIS Dotspatial developing environment,using C# and Oracle database to develop on the base of the system framework of the combination of plug-in development and components development.It achieves geographical base map basic operation using related methods such as Dotspatial's ZoomIn,ZoomOut,Pan,Symbology,Analysis and Projection;realizes the map's zooming in and out,displaying and hiding,moving,legend edition and distance and area measuring based on studying the regional measurement algorithm;establishes graticules dynamic data drawing model,dynamically draw graticule by acquiring real time longitude and latitude range on screen using Map.PixelToProj;draws seismic intensity map using LinearRine combined with linear source intensity model,meanwhile display prefecture-level city in the affected region;realizes the trimming of the working space of maps by users' selection of the display scope of the region computing Map widget;compares the ‘ten five' precursory observing data in precursory observing Oracle database with the threshold value set by specialists using Echarts developing technique,display the precursory data by maps and charts.This system's realization completely solves MapInfo's copyright problem,gives technical support to the earthquake analysis and forecast industry.The system is currently deployed and installed in seismological bureau in Sichuan,Yunnan,Gansu and Hebei province and has gained favorable feedbacks.
